Kenting is in the southern part of Taiwan. It is a popular beach area bordering on the tropical region of Taiwan. Don’t hesitate to rent a bike and explore the (flat) surroundings.

Kenting is also a National Park of Taiwan, with many tropical plants such as palm trees, a few banana trees, and even sugar canes. Good place to swim and dive.

Eluanbi Park
Edit This

Eluanbi Park was created in 1982 to provide an appropriate venue for people coming to visit Taiwan's southernmost point and one of the peninsula's most notable landmarks, the Eluanbi Lighthouse, also called "The Light of East Asia". It stands 21.4 meters high and is reputedly the brightest lighthouse in Asia. The park covers an area of 59 hectares. Within the park there are a number of recreational facilities and a wide range of interesting geological, botanical, and ornithological features. The area covered by the park is also one of the sites of Kenting's prehistoric cultures. more..

________Practical Information
Edit This
There are no money-changers in Kenting and, interestingly, no banks either. There are a couple of ATMs which can be used. The two 5-star hotels change money only for their guests. Although some local vendors might agree to change money, it's unusual. Make sure that you have enough money for the duration of your stay.

There is a bank right next to the bus-station in the nearby town of Hengchun. But it's closed on Sundays and public holidays.

____Getting Around
Edit This

Sorry no taxi's here. If you want to get around Kenting and see some sights it will be necessary to rent a scooter or a car. Scooter rentals are available just about anywhere so this shouldn't be a worry.

Buses run between Kenting and Kaoshiung regularly for those coming and going.

Buses and cabs
Edit This

Kenting is about 7km from Hengchun. Hengchun is well connected by the nearby big city of Kaohsiung by frequent buses.

One can catch a bus to Hengchun from Kaohsiung international airport, or from the bus station nearby Kaohsiung train station. Frequency of buses is about 30-40min.

_______Beaches
Edit This

The main strip of beach in Kenting is practically controlled by the large resorts. However it is accessible to everyone. You will be required to pay a small fee for a chair and umbrella.

Nanwan is also a popular beach area that is quite a bit larger. Here you will see all kinds of water sports. Shops line the road with scuba/snorkelling gear and restaurants. There are also changing/shower facilities here.

Shado Beach is an ecologically protected area so no swimming.

Baisha Beach is about 30 minutes north west of Kenting and it literally means "white sand beach". During the week you could be lucky enough to be the only one on the beach.

There is so much to do in and around Kenting. Take a 30 minute scooter drive to Baisha and enjoy the white sand beach. Camping is available here as well. On your back to town stop at Maubitou (Cat's Nose Peak) for a beautiful view of the ocean and coral reefs. From here stop at Houphiwu Marina and go on a glass bottom boat for a view of the amazing underwater life.

Nanwan beach is the largest beach in the area and you can rent sea doo's and banana boats and boogie boards. Take a walk down the beach and find Bud who will take you out on his catamaran for a nominal fee.

There's not much to see at the Kenting Youth Activity Center but take a walk around Frog Rock for some worthwhile sights. Also take some time to drive to and walk through the Kenting Forest Recreation area as well as Sheding Park. Explore caves, see the wild life and enjoy the view!

From here head south and stop and see Sail Rock, the profile resembles President Nixon. There are lots of shops renting snorkeling gear.

A little ways down the hightway is Shado beach which is an ecologically protected area and the sands glitter with shells. Although you can't walk on the sand check out the small museum here.

Continue down the highway to Eluanbi which is one of the few fortified light houses in the world. This is also the most southern point in Taiwan. Walk along the paths here and check out Kissing Rock. A great place for couples.

From here head north to Longpan Park which is situated in grasslands and is a huge cliff over looking the Pacific. A little farther north is Fongchueisha. This is another ecologically protected coastal area that is hosts to sand dunes.

Remember after a long day of sight seeing or relaxing on the beach to check out Kenting's night light and frantastic night markets.
